#326538 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#326538 is composed of 19.6% red, 39.6%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 44.6% yellow and 60.4% black. It has a hue angle of 127.1 degrees, a saturation of 33.8% and a lightness of 29.6%. #326538 color hex could be obtained by blending #64ca70 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#326538 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#326538 has RGB values of R:50, G:101,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0.5, M:0, Y:0.45,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 3302712.

Shades and Tints of #326538
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050905 is the darkest color, while #fbfdfb is the lightest one.
